Do you have any tips for my flight to Paris?
- It's simple — first, pack in your passport, travel documents, bank cards and medications. Next, you'll need some extra in-flight entertainment to while away the time. A thrilling book and a phone crammed with your favourite shows are some great options. If you plan to take a quick nap, a comfy neck pillow and a pair of earplugs will also come in handy. Finally, leave some space for a toothbrush and some deodorant so you'll arrive looking fresh and raring to go.
- Put all your full-sized bottles of hair gel and hairspray in your checked baggage. Any liquids in your carry-on bag larger than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res) will be confiscated by authorities. Pointed or sharp objects, like your trusty Swiss Army knife, and dangerous goods which are explosive or flammable, such as aerosol cans, spray paint and fireworks, are also not allowed.
- The aisles of an airplane are no place for a fashion parade. Dress in comfortable layers and go for shoes that are closed-toe, flat and easy to take on and off.
- The result of sustained periods of inactivity, deep vein thrombosis (DVT) is a blood clotting condition that can affect some passengers on long-haul flights. Reduce the risks by drinking water, keeping your ankles and legs moving and wearing compression tights or socks.
How to get through airport security fast when flying to Paris?
- Your travel documents and passport will need to be shown to airport security. Keep them at hand so you don't hold up the queue.
- Time to strip down. Well kind of. Your belt, coat, keys and other items in your pocket, like your earphones, will need to go on a tray through the X-ray machine. Make the whole process faster by removing them before your turn arrives.
- All your electronic devices, including your phone and tablet, must also be separately scanned.
- Remove all liquids and gels from your hand luggage. They usually need to be sent through the X-ray scanner separately. Each item should be no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res) and everything must fit in a single quart-size (one litre), clear zip-lock bag.
- Lightweight sneakers are a clever footwear choice as you're less likely to be required to remove them when going through security. Boots and heavier-style shoes are usually subjected to additional screening.
- Sharp items are prohibited in the cabin. They'll be confiscated at security, so pack them in your checked bags.
